Transaction 51269ff05d160ba4b20433a0cd55c915bb84a1232c21c67d0f823311c6b0674a

6 Input
2 Outputs
  • 51269ff05d160ba4b20433a0cd55c915bb84a1232c21c67d0f823311c6b0674a:0
  • value  149950000
    address  1NFTKfS7ca7hkkjLg4QGJ1cafqgQcVEkK1
  • 51269ff05d160ba4b20433a0cd55c915bb84a1232c21c67d0f823311c6b0674a:1
  • value  10576033
    address  3Cj7qWp9ASy7u3uoUBaRbaBoTWDq1PybUr